文摘
Novel liquid-crystal materials based on 1-alkyl-4-[5-(dodecylsulfanyl)-1,3,4-oxadiazol-2-yl]pyridinium bromide derivatives were synthesized. Their thermotropic polymorphism wasinvestigated by polarizing optical microscopy and differential scanning calorimetry. Thestructures of their crystalline and smectic A phases were investigated by X-ray diffraction.The existence of thermochromic properties in the smectic phase as well as their UV-visibleand fluorescence properties were also studied. The chemical structure of the compoundsrenders these materials suitable for optoelectronic applications.
